stra·tig·ra·phy
[struh-tig-ruh-fee] Pronunciation Key
—Related forms
[struh-tig-ruh-fee] Pronunciation Key –noun
| a branch of geology dealing with the classification, nomenclature, correlation, and interpretation of stratified rocks. |
—Related forms
stra·tig·ra·pher, stra·tig·ra·phist, noun
strat·i·graph·i·cal·ly, adverb

| stra·tig·ra·phy
(strə-tĭg'rə-fē) Pronunciation Key
n. The study of rock strata, especially the distribution, deposition, and age of sedimentary rocks. strat'i·graph'ic (strāt'ĭ-grāf'ĭk), strat'i·graph'i·cal (-ĭ-kəl) adj., strat'i·graph'i·cal·ly adv. |

| stratigraphy
(strə-tĭg'rə-fē) Pronunciation Key
The scientific study of rock strata, especially the distribution, deposition, correlation, and age of sedimentary rocks. |
